需要学习的API// 创建消息摘要对象MessageDigest digest = MessageDigest.getInstance(algorithm);// 执行消息摘要算法byte[] digest1 = digest.digest(input.getBytes());转16进制,需要注意一位的时候高位补0
import java.io.ByteArrayOutputStream;
im
原创
2021-07-28 09:57:32
132阅读
1、字符串定义与产生str1 ='Hello world'str2 ="Hello world"#双引号比单引号定义的字符串更加强大,如可提供转移字符等str3 =%q/Hello world/# %q将后面的字符串转换成单引号字符串,后面的/为自定义的特殊符号,在字符串结尾处也需有该特殊符号str4 =%Q/Hello world/# %Q将定义双引号字符串2
原创
2013-05-30 10:05:15
647阅读
说到文章摘要大家并不陌生,就是给长文本在不丢失任何重要信息的情况下做个精确的总结。具体有哪些方法呢?可以看以下总结。
方法引用 ,构造引用,数组引用
翻译
2021-08-13 09:27:46
88阅读
构造方法/构造器 基本语法 【修饰符】 方法名(形参列表){ 方法体 } 说明 构造器的修饰符可以默认,也可以是public protected private 构造器没有返回值 方法名和类名字必须一样 参数列表和成员方法一样的规则 构造器的调用由系统完成 基本介绍 构造方法又叫构造器,是类的一 ...
转载
2021-08-09 23:46:00
165阅读
2评论
using System;using System.Collections.Generic;using System.Linq;using System.Text;namespace Test{ //抽象类不能是密封的或静态的。 抽象类的成员仅仅能被子类的对象来调用。注:抽象成员须要子类ov...
转载
2015-09-21 20:17:00
41阅读
2评论
对象的产生格式:Student s = new Student() ;
一实例化对象,则构造方法会被自动调用。
通过构造方法,为类中的属性初始化
原创
2008-08-05 17:09:21
1072阅读
11.2.2 默认构造方法
默认构造方法是没有参数的构造方法,可分为两种:(1)隐含的默认构造方法;(2)程序显式定义的默认构造方法。
在Java语言中,每个类至少有一个构造方法。为了保证这一点,如果用户定义的类中没有提供任何构造方法,那么Java语言将自动提供一个隐含的默认构造方法。该构造方法没有参数,用public 修饰,而且方法体为空,格式如下:
public ClassName(){
转载
2009-06-20 20:00:38
498阅读
11.2.4 构造方法的作用域
构造方法只能通过以下方式被调用:
当前类的其他构造方法通过this语句调用它。
当前类的子类的构造方法通过super语句调用它。
在程序中通过new语句调用它。
对于例程11-4(Sub.java)的代码,请读者自己分析某些语句编译出错的原因。
例程11-4 Sub.java
class Base{
public Base(i
转载
2009-06-20 20:01:53
407阅读
1、成员变量都有默认值
2、局部变量没有初始值
3、构造方法的作用:完成初始化工作,例如给成员变量赋初值
4、默认提供一个无参数的构造方法
5、构造方法和类名相同,没有返回值类型
1、如果提供了带参数的构造方法,将不再提供无参数的构造方法,需要手动添加
2、this关键字代表当前对象,可以用来修饰属
转载
2011-08-09 20:43:51
394阅读
public class FirstDemo {
/** * 构造方法 */ // 定义成员属性 public FirstDemo(String name) { System.out.print("工作方法在实例化对象中产生"); }
public static void main(String
原创
2012-06-30 14:31:11
430阅读
构造方法(structuremethod) 解析:在Java中,任何变量在被使用前都必须先设置初值.Java提供了为类的成员变量赋初值的专门功能:构造方法(constructor)构造方法是一种特殊的成员方法,构造方法:方法名与类名一样,没有返回值包括void。 注意: 1、 构造方法不能通过对象名
原创
2011-09-23 08:54:00
323阅读
特点:
方法名称和类名系统
没有返回值类型,连void也没有
没有具体的返回值
作用: 对数据进行初始化的
注意事项:
构造方法也是有return语句的,格式是return;
如果我们没有给出构造方法,那么系统会提供一个无参的构造方法
如果我们给出了构造方法,那么系统就不会系统无参的构造方法
转载
2021-08-12 17:12:42
50阅读
构造方法其实在写好一个自定义的类时,这个类本身就有一个默认的空参数构造方法,只是不用自己去写出来,但是在有些时候,需要对它的成员变量在创建对象的时候就进行初始化值,这时就需要重写构造方法,也就是构造器。构造方法的作用就是对成员变量进行默认初始化值。构造方法的定义格式修饰符 方法名(参数列表){}修饰符:也就是它的权限问题方法名:定义必须和类名完全一致参数列表:如果需要对成员变量在创建对象的时候就进
原创
2018-01-15 09:58:25
621阅读
构造方法what构造方法也叫构造器,构造函数,本质就是一个特殊的方法feature构造方法的方法名和类名一致构造方法没有返回值类型构造方法可以重载构造方法不可以手动调用,只能在创建对象的时,jvm自动调用构造方法在创建对象时只能调用一次class Students { String name; int age; public Students() { } public Students(String name)
原创
2021-07-08 17:49:26
82阅读
什么是构造方法 构造方法是一种很特别的方法 在创建实例的时候进行初始化操作 默认构造方法 如果在类中没写构造方法 编译器会自动加上一个空的构造方法 名称和 类名一样 类似这样 class Demo01 { public Demo01() { } } 构造方法没有返回值!!!! 自定义构造方法 如果自 ...
转载
2021-07-13 16:31:00
60阅读
2评论
构造方法,又叫构造函数。其实就是对类进行初始化。构造方法与类同名,无返回值,也不需要void,在new时候调用。所有类都有构造方法,如果你不编码则系统默认生成空的构造方法,若你有定义的构造方法,那么默认的构造方法就会失效了。class Cat { private string name = ""; public Cat(string name) { this.name = name; } public string Shout() { return "我¨°的Ì?名?字Á?叫D:êo"+name+&quo
转载
2013-12-31 09:18:00
86阅读
2评论
1.构造方法的相关概念 * Java的类都要求有构造方法,如果没有定义构造方法,Java编译器会为我们提供一个默认的构造方法,默认构造方法就是指不带参数的构造方法 * 如果类中有一个自己编写的构造方法时,编译器就不会为我们再提供那个默认构造方法。如果此时又希望还可以用默认构造方法来创建类的实例时,那
转载
2016-02-21 21:11:00
142阅读
2评论
1.重写init方法 想在对象创建完毕后,成员变量马上就有一些默认的值就可以重写init方法 重写init方法格式: 想在对象创建完毕后,成员变量马上就有一些默认的值就可以重写init方法 重写init方法格式: + [super init]的作用: 面向对象的体现,先利用父类的init方法为子类实
转载
2017-03-18 20:15:00
57阅读
2评论